Amy’s Kitchen has issued a voluntary recall for select batches of its lentil soup after discovering a potential contamination that could pose health risks. The recall affects products distributed across the United States, and consumers are advised to check their packaging immediately. This development is significant because it involves a widely consumed vegetarian product, raising concerns about food safety and supply chain oversight.
The recall was announced on March 15, 2024, by Amy’s Kitchen, a major producer of organic and vegetarian foods. According to the company, the affected lentil soup batches may contain undeclared allergens or foreign substances due to possible contamination during manufacturing. The specific products involved are identified by lot numbers and expiration dates, which consumers can find on the packaging. The company has not yet confirmed the exact nature of the contamination but has emphasized that no illnesses have been reported so far.
Consumers who purchased the affected lentil soup are advised to discontinue use immediately and dispose of the product. Amy’s Kitchen has also set up a dedicated hotline and website for consumers to verify whether their product is part of the recall and to seek refunds or replacements. Retailers and distributors have been notified to remove the affected products from shelves.

Background on Amy’s Kitchen and Food Recall Trends
Amy’s Kitchen is a leading producer of organic, vegetarian, and vegan foods, with a strong presence in grocery stores nationwide. The company has previously issued recalls for various products due to contamination concerns, including metal fragments and undeclared allergens. Food recalls in the U.S. have increased in recent years, driven by stricter safety regulations and supply chain complexities. This latest recall follows a pattern of proactive measures by companies to prevent potential health risks, though it also highlights ongoing challenges in maintaining consistent quality control across production facilities.

Unconfirmed Details About the Contamination Source
It is not yet clear what specific contaminant prompted the recall or how it entered the production process. The company has not disclosed whether the issue involves microbial contamination, foreign objects, or allergen cross-contact. Investigations are ongoing, and further information from Amy’s Kitchen or regulatory agencies is expected in the coming days.
